Ptarmigan Moon - Home Ceremony

Preparation

Read a little about the ptarmigan and its meaning. The ptarmigan, or rievssat in Sami, is regarded as an ancestor bird. When it draws near to humans, it can be seen as the ancestors showing themselves.

Feel free to write down your intention for the ceremony: ancestral power, strength, success, energy, self-insight, rest, magic, spontaneity or the ability to let go.

A candle (indoors) or a small fire/lantern (outdoors) represents the sacred fire.

Indoor version

Prepare the room

Clear a space, open the window for fresh air. Place a candle in the middle of the room.

Welcome

Sit down, breathe calmly, light the candle and say:

"I open the sacred space beneath the Ptarmigan Moon. Welcome ancestors, welcome spirit of the ptarmigan."

Cleansing

You can use incense, sage or simply run your hands along the body to "brush away" what weighs you down.

The journey to the ancestors

Beat the drum or rattle softly. Close your eyes and picture a ptarmigan showing itself. Follow it on an inner journey to the land of the ancestors. There you can build a small gamme (turf hut) or a house for the ancestors, and receive their blessing.

Return and sharing

End the drumming, breathe deeply and write down what you experienced in a notebook.

Closing

Thank the ancestors and the spirit of the ptarmigan. Symbolically blow three breaths on the flame before you put out the candle: one for the past, one for the present, one for the future.

Outdoor version

Preparation

Find a quiet place outdoors. Tidy the ground a little. Set up a lantern or light a small fire (if possible).

Opening the space

Stand upright, look at the moon. Say:

"Here I open the sacred space beneath the Ptarmigan Moon. Welcome to the spirits, the powers, the ancestors."

Cleansing

Take a few steps around the fire or lantern. Sweep the smoke over yourself or shake your body lightly as if to shake off the old.

The journey

Drum or sing simply. Follow the flutters of the ptarmigan in your imagination - see the ptarmigan lead you through the landscape to a place where the ancestors wait. Give them thanks, and build a house for them in your inner image.

Return

When you are finished, stand still and look at the moon. Let the silence be the answer from the ancestors.

Closing

Say:

"Thanks to the Ptarmigan, thanks to the ancestors. The circle is closed, but the connection remains." Put out the fire or lantern.

After the ceremony - The social space

Even alone you can mark this part.

Drink a cup of tea, eat something you like.

Play the drum or make rhythms for a while to celebrate.

Remind yourself that traditionally this was a time for community, gratitude and the sharing of stories.
